Job summary

Hamilton County Schools is seeking a coordinator to lead East Hamilton High School's parent volunteer program. You will organize, develop, and implement volunteer opportunities, foster strong parent and community involvement, and document hours for reporting and recognition.

The role requires coordinating with teachers, administrators, and parents to support school activities, ensuring confidentiality, and aligning with district policies and goals for student success.

The purpose of this job is to coordinate parent volunteer activities.

East Hamilton High School is a diverse 9-12 school located in Ooltewah, Tennessee, just outside Chattanooga. We are recognized for excellence across academics, athletics, and the arts, and we are committed to preparing students for success in college, careers, and beyond. Our academic opportunities include a full range of Honors and Advanced Placement courses, as well as programs in business, AV production, and fine arts, ensuring that every student can discover and develop their unique talents.
